The Character of the Fragrance and the Story Behind Its Release

Possets Perfume Canopic Box is a men's fragrance in an oil perfume format, released in 2012.

The composition belongs to the woody family, combining the pronounced dryness of noble woods with deep balsamic nuances.

This is a fragrance with a distinct character, intended for those who prefer not light, watercolor-like formulas, but a rich and memorable scent.

The fragrance was created by Possets Perfume, an American niche brand founded in Cincinnati in 2006.

Its creator, Fabienne Christenson, has a scientific background in physics, and this unusual professional experience is clearly reflected in her approach to perfumery: the brand's compositions are often perceived as independent experiments with materials, density, and contrasts.

The Fragrance Pyramid and How It Develops on the Skin

The database does not list separate top, heart, and base notes for Canopic Box, so its development is described as a unified woody-balsamic accord.

At the heart of the composition are cedar, ho wood, labdanum, oud, and teak wood.

Together, they create a dry, resinous, slightly spicy impression of dark wood, a warmed surface, and noble depth.

The cedar nuance gives the structure a clean verticality and keeps the scent composed, while oud adds density and characteristic oriental intensity.

With its camphoraceous nuances, ho wood can lend the accord a cool, slightly piercing edge, while labdanum softens the woody austerity with a warm, resinous texture.

Teak wood reinforces the effect of a dense, smooth, and confident trail.

Sillage, Concentration, and Wearability

Canopic Box is an oil perfume with very strong sillage.

This concentration usually develops more densely and softly close to the skin than alcohol-based formats, but the composition's high intensity makes it noticeable even in small amounts.

The precise amount to apply to skin and clothing is not specified for this release, so it is best to start with a minimal application and gradually increase it if necessary.

In terms of mood, this is a fragrance for cool weather, evening outings, and occasions when you want to emphasize your individuality.

The woody-balsamic profile feels especially at home in autumn and winter, while in hot weather it may seem overly intense.

Its gender labeling indicates a masculine positioning, but women who enjoy oud, resinous, and dry woody fragrances may also find an intriguing facet in it.

The Perfumer and Its Place in the Brand's Style

Canopic Box was created by Fabienne Christenson.

Her work with woody and balsamic materials is built around contrast: austere woods gain volume through resinous and camphoraceous nuances, while the dense texture retains its expressive graphic quality.

As a result, the fragrance feels less like a versatile everyday companion and more like a niche perfume portrait with a powerful atmosphere.
